FATHER MATERNE LAFFINEUR (D. 1970)


Born in 1897 in Walcourt, Belgium, Fr. Materne Laffineur, O.P., was ordained to the priesthood in 1924. He was later to be involved in the canonical inquiry about the apparitions of Beuraing and become as early as 1963, the unofficial or private investigator of the Garabandal "facts," on behalf of Msgr. Beitia himself. A tireless diffuser of the Message in France and in the world, he worked without respite, so that the supernatural authenticity of the events might be recognized by the Church, gathering the most abundant documentation on the question.
In July 1965, Conchita is said to have transmitted to him, in a letter, these presumed words from the Blessed Virgin concerning the Dominican priest: "Tell . . . Fr. Laffineur in France that my Son has chosen him to spread the Message I gave to the world, tell him also my love for everyone . . . I shall always be with (him) and so will my Son." Fr. Laffineur had witnessed many ecstasies in San Sebastian de Garabandal.

FRIDAY, OCTOBER 11, 1962:


The assembly of Bishops in St. Peter's Basilica

CONCHITA FALLS IN ECSTASY AT THE
EXACT MOMENT OF THE OPENING, IN
ROME, OF THE ECUMENICAL COUNCIL
VATICAN II


On the morning of the Opening of the Second Vatican Council, it was raining heavily in Rome. But when the Conciliar Fathers started in procession towards St. Peter's Basilica, the sky suddenly cleared up and the sun came out again.
At that same moment, another amazing phenomenon was unfolding at Garabandal; just as the radio was transmitting, at 8 a.m., the Opening of the Council and the inauguration ceremony, Conchita fell into ecstasy in her home; it lasted throughout her wandering through the lanes of the village, where witnesses could hear the seer talking of the Council with her Vision!
The visionary, who did not yet know the date, asked the apparition if the Miracle would occur during the Council. The beginning of an answer would be given to her during an important
ecstasy, on the following 18th of November.

Reverend Ramon Garcia de la Riva had spent, in the company of several other persons, the night of October 10 to 11 at Conchita's house. In order to enliven the long vigil, each had tried to guess the time when the visionary would have her ecstasy. The pastor of Barro alone found the right answer.

Msgr. Beitia was in Rome, sitting with his peers, when the newspapers published his first Note. The "aficionados" of Garabandal were obviously very disappointed. But Conchita, in a letter that she would send on that very same day to Fr. Ramon Andreu, reported, on behalf of the Blessed Virgin, that "the bishop (of Santander) in reality had a strong interior desire and real hope to discern the true origin of a matter of such gravity."

TUEDAY, OCTOBER 8, 1962:


Jacinta is happy again.

MARI-LOLI AND JACINTA, IN TURN, LEARN,
AS EARLY AS THE DAY FOLLOWING
THE NOTA OF MSGR. BEITIA, ABOUT
THE COMING OF A VERY GREAT MIRACLE


After a month of deprivation because of a new disobedience to her parents, Jacinta began to have ecstasies again. Mary revealed to her, and to Loli as well, the existence of Msgr. Beitia's first Note, written on the previous day but which was to be made public only on the following 19th of October. In this Note, the Bishop of Santander seemed to adopt completely the position of his predecessor, Msgr. Doroteo Fernandez, renewing in it the dispositions taken by the "Special Commission," and restating, out of pastoral prudence, the interdiction and warnings concerning Garabandal.
We must nevertheless emphasize here that Msgr. Beitia, the only titular Bishop of Santander at the time of the apparitions, was to display a very remarkable tact with regard to this "matter" of Garabandal. In the face of the "adversaries of the events," he would, like the famous Gamaliel (Acts 6:1; 22:3), use the most appropriate words: "It is not necessary to use here one's fists: things that do not proceed from God, sooner or later crumble on their own" . . .
On this October 8, 1962, the two visionaries especially learned of the coming of the future great Miracle that would prove the authenticity of the Messages and the "events" occurring at San Sebastian de Garabandal.
